U-11's Advance to Power Cup Final   19/05/2015

Mervue Utd 3-1 Renmore (U-11 Kevin Power Cup Semi-Final)

Mervue Utd's under 11's advanced to the final of the Kevin Power Cup with a great win over neighbours Renmore last Wednesday following a 3-1 win after extra time.

Two goals from Keane Griffin and another from Kian Keavey was enough to see off a very strong Renmore side.

Mervue led at the break with a great finish from Keane Griffin on the stroke of half time but Renmore deservedly levelled matters in the second half.

The game ended 1-1 so extra time was required to find a winner and Griffin was on hand to finish to the net following good build up play from Mikey Kelly and give Mervue the edge once again. 

Mervue added a third goal when Kian Keavey was in the right place to hammer home to make it 3-1 late on and send his side into the final and put them on course to win the Power Cup for the second year running having only captured the 2014 title last November.

Best for Mervue were Ciaran Kinsella, Finn Mclntyre, Keane Griffin, Connor Fahy, Joshua and Matthew O'Connor, Tommy and Jamie Hayes, Kian Keavey and Niall Jordon.

The final will take place against Athenry on Saturday 30th May at 12 noon in Eamonn Deacy Park .
